                 Observation


                 Students will observe the Micro:bit displaying a diamond pattern on its
                 display. They will notice that when specific coordinates are programmed

                 to light up, the diamond shape appears. Students can also observe how
                 changing the sequence of the lights creates different patterns. They will

                 also notice that using loops in code can help animate the diamond, making
                 it blink or move.


                 Application

                 Digital  Displays:  This  activity  shows
                 students  how  patterns  and  shapes  can  be

                 created with lights, like how digital billboards
                 or  scoreboards  display  numbers,  words,  or

                 symbols using lights.
